What Are Remote Tax Support Jobs Like? 

Remote tax support professionals assist customers with tax-related questions and services through phone, chat, or online platforms. Depending on the role, responsibilities may include helping customers navigate tax software, answering general questions, troubleshooting technical issues, or supporting experienced tax preparers. 

While some opportunities require tax knowledge or previous experience, others provide training and focus more heavily on customer service and technical support. Strong communication skills, attention to detail, patience, and comfort using technology are especially valuable.

Who is a Good Fit? 

Successful remote tax support professionals are typically calm under pressure, comfortable explaining information clearly, and committed to protecting sensitive customer information. A quiet workspace, reliable internet connection, and the ability to stay organized are also important. 

Because tax season can be busy, the best candidates are prepared to remain focused while delivering friendly, accurate support.
